Explore advanced quantum field theory concepts in this conference talk featuring two presentations on magnetic field effects in quantum matter. Learn about the quark anomalous magnetic moment in extreme magnetic field conditions from Cristian Villavicencio of Universidad del BÃo-BÃo, Chile, who examines how quarks behave under intense magnetic influences. Discover unusual quark effective interactions arising from vacuum polarization under relatively weak magnetic fields through Fabio Braghin's research from Universidade Federal de Goiás. Gain insights into cutting-edge theoretical physics research presented at the 9th Conference on Chirality, Vorticity and Magnetic Fields in Quantum Matter, hosted by ICTP-SAIFR, covering fundamental aspects of particle physics and quantum chromodynamics in magnetic environments.
